Igboefon's Pulse: Daily Rhythms of Nigerian Life

Igboefon, Nigeria, offers a rich tapestry of daily life, where traditional practices blend seamlessly with modern urban rhythms. This vibrant community, situated on the African continent, presents a captivating blend of unique characters, cultural expressions, and the bustling energy of its streets. From dynamic street scenes to quiet artistic statements, Igboefon’s narrative is as diverse as its people.

A striking sight on a paved road captures an adult male gracefully riding a dappled grey horse under a clear blue sky. Dressed in a white tank top and plaid trousers, he guides the horse with reins and a thin stick, embodying a timeless mode of transport amidst contemporary residential buildings. This scene vividly illustrates the blend of heritage and everyday practicality that defines many Nigerian communities.

The streets also serve as a stage for compelling individual expressions. A young man with an elaborate afro and stylish sunglasses is seen beside a pickup truck, engrossed in his smartphone, a snapshot of modern youth in an urban setting. Elsewhere, two men seated on a wooden bench offer a glimpse into local camaraderie, one of them adorned with dreadlocks, colorful beads, and a distinctive lion head pendant, reflecting a rich personal and cultural aesthetic.

Art and craft also find their place in Igboefon’s public spaces. A terracotta statue of a male figure, adorned with a woven hat and a small pot, stands as a testament to local artistry, set against a concrete wall with other sculptural elements. Similarly, a young man carrying a manual sewing machine on his shoulder, ready for work, embodies the entrepreneurial spirit and resourcefulness prevalent in the community. These multifaceted scenes collectively paint a vivid picture of Igboefon’s unique pulse, a true reflection of life across the African continent.
